> Currently JDBC connection against a secure Phoenix cluster requires a
> Kerberos principal and keytab to be passed in as part of the connection
> string. But in many instances users may not have a {{Keytab}} especially
> during development. It would be good to support using the logged in users
> Kerberos ticket.
